func (health Health) Check() error {
healthCheckURL, err := url.Parse(health.URL)
if err != nil {
return fmt.Errorf("error parsing HealthCheck URL: %v ", err)
}
// Create a new request for the route
healthReq, err := http.NewRequest("GET", healthCheckURL.String(), nil)
if err != nil {
return fmt.Errorf("error route %s: creating HealthCheck request: %v ", health.Name, err)
}
// Create custom transport with TLS configuration
transport := &http.Transport{
TLSClientConfig: &tls.Config{
InsecureSkipVerify: health.InsecureSkipVerify, // Skip SSL certificate verification
},
}
// Perform the request to the route's healthcheck
client := &http.Client{Transport: transport, Timeout: health.TimeOut}
healthResp, err := client.Do(healthReq)
if err != nil {
logger.Debug("Error route %s: performing HealthCheck request: %v ", health.Name, err)
return fmt.Errorf("error performing HealthCheck request: %v ", err)
}
defer func(Body io.ReadCloser) {
err := Body.Close()
if err != nil {
logger.Debug("Error performing HealthCheck request: %v ", err)
}
}(healthResp.Body)
if len(health.HealthyStatuses) > 0 {
if !slices.Contains(health.HealthyStatuses, healthResp.StatusCode) {
logger.Debug("Error: Route %s: health check failed with status code %d", health.Name, healthResp.StatusCode)
return fmt.Errorf("health check failed with status code %d", healthResp.StatusCode)
}
} else {
if healthResp.StatusCode >= 400 {
logger.Debug("Error: Route %s: health check failed with status code %d", health.Name, healthResp.StatusCode)
return fmt.Errorf("health check failed with status code %d", healthResp.StatusCode)
}
}
return nil
}
func routesHealthCheck(routes []Route) {
for _, health := range healthCheckRoutes(routes) {
go func() {
err := health.createHealthCheckJob()
if err != nil {
logger.Error("Error creating healthcheck job: %v ", err)
return
}
}()
}
}
func (health Health) createHealthCheckJob() error {
interval := "30s"
if len(health.Interval) > 0 {
interval = health.Interval
}
expression := fmt.Sprintf("@every %s", interval)
if !util.IsValidCronExpression(expression) {
logger.Error("Health check interval is invalid: %s", interval)
logger.Info("Route health check ignored")
return fmt.Errorf("health check interval is invalid: %s", interval)
}
// Create a new cron instance
c := cron.New()
_, err := c.AddFunc(expression, func() {
err := health.Check()
if err != nil {
logger.Error("Route %s is unhealthy: %v", health.Name, err.Error())
return
}
logger.Info("Route %s is healthy", health.Name)
})
if err != nil {
return err
}
// Start the cron scheduler
c.Start()
defer c.Stop()
select {}
}
